תוכן עניינים:

כיצד אוכל להעביר קוד SVN מ-github להיסטוריה?
כיצד אוכל להעביר קוד SVN מ-github להיסטוריה?

וִידֵאוֹ: כיצד אוכל להעביר קוד SVN מ-github להיסטוריה?

וִידֵאוֹ: כיצד אוכל להעביר קוד SVN מ-github להיסטוריה?
וִידֵאוֹ: DEEPEST DIVE into the MM Finance ecosystem [CRYPTO ANALYSIS] 2024, מרץ
Anonim
  1. שלב 1: אחזר רשימה של SVN הגדר שמות משתמש. א SVN commit מציג רק את שם המשתמש של המשתמש.
  2. שלב 2: התאמה SVN שמות משתמש לכתובות דואר אלקטרוני.
  3. שלב 3: להגר ל Git באמצעות git - svn פיקוד שיבוט.
  4. שלב 1: קבע את הקבצים הגדולים.
  5. שלב 2: נקה את הקבצים מה- Git History .

באופן דומה אפשר לשאול, איך אני מעביר את היסטוריית SVN למאגר Git חדש?

פירקנו את תהליך ההעברה של SVN-to-Git ל-5 שלבים פשוטים:

  1. הכן את הסביבה שלך להגירה.
  2. המר את מאגר ה-SVN למאגר Git מקומי.
  3. סנכרן את מאגר Git המקומי כאשר מאגר ה-SVN משתנה.
  4. שתף את מאגר Git עם המפתחים שלך באמצעות Bitbucket.

כמו כן, כיצד אוכל להעביר קוד מ-GitHub? אם ברצונך להשתמש בממשק המשתמש של GitHub, תוכל לבצע את השלבים הבאים:

  1. לחץ על כפתור "+" ובחר "הוסף מאגר מקומי"
  2. נווט אל הספרייה עם הקוד הקיים שלך ולחץ על כפתור "הוסף".
  3. כעת אתה אמור להתבקש "צור כאן מאגר Git מקומי חדש" אז לחץ על כפתור "כן".

באופן דומה, אנשים שואלים, איך אני עובר מ-SVN ל-Git?

הם הפורמט המומלץ עבור מאגרים משותפים

  1. אחזר רשימה של כל מבצעי החתרנות.
  2. שיבוט את מאגר Subversion באמצעות git-svn.
  3. המר מאפייני svn:ignore ל.
  4. דחף מאגר למאגר git חשוף.
  5. שנה את שם הענף של "תא המטען" ל"מאסטר"
  6. לנקות ענפים ותגים.
  7. לִשְׁתוֹת.

איך SVN מסתנכרן עם Git?

סנכרון מ-SVN ל-Git

  1. בדוק את סניף המעקב של SVN. git checkout svnsync-DEV_1_0_0_Release.
  2. אחזר את השינויים האחרונים מ-SVN. git svn rebase.
  3. עבור למאסטר ומיזג את ענף המעקב של SVN. git checkout master.
  4. דחף את השינויים הממוזגים ל-GitHub origin master. git push origin master.

מוּמלָץ: